Morning Report

The FTSE 100 trades flat, paring gains after data showing that the UK government borrowed more than expected in May. Serco is the biggest loser, down 2.7% after its pre-close update.. Resource firms and banks partly recovered from a recent sharp selloff, while Royal Bank of Scotland is still suffering from a tech glitch.

Mining firms helped ensure the index traded in positive territory in morning action, with heavyweights Rio Tinto PLC 1.6% higher, BHP Billiton PLC up 1.2% and Anglo American PLC adding 1.5%. Metals prices were, however, mostly lower.

Oil prices, on the other hand, inched higher after dropping 0.7% the prior day. BP PLC followed the prices higher and added 1.4%, while BG Group PLC gained 1.1%.

Moody's lowers its long-term ratings on 28 Spanish banks by one to four notes and lowers two issuer ratings, pointing to the country's reduced creditworthiness.

Ocado Group PLC said Duncan Tatton-Brown will join as chief executive officer from Sept. 1, as the online grocer reported slight growth in half-year profit.
